What’s the optical port on my TV for?

A relic from a (lately) forgotten age

Credit score: Hustvedt / Inventive Commons

What you are is usually generally known as a TOSLINK or S/PDIF connector. The primary time period stems from the format’s creator, Toshiba, which initially developed it in 1983 as a method of delivering PCM (pulse-code modulated) audio from its CD gamers to its receivers. S/PDIF stands for Sony/Philips Digital Interface, which additionally refers to a separate copper cable kind that is fallen out of favor. As you have little question guessed, TOSLINK is brief for Toshiba Hyperlink.

The know-how ultimately made its method past Toshiba and into the house theater house, changing into a most well-liked choice for lovers. That is as a result of it makes use of fiber optics, enabling not simply high-speed information switch, however immunity from points that plagued earlier cable varieties, together with RF interference and floor loops (a supply of hum and different undesirable noise).

The format’s creator, Toshiba, initially developed it in 1983 as a method of delivering PCM audio from its CD gamers to its receivers.

Functionally, the format helps two channels of uncompressed PCM audio, in addition to a number of compressed encompass codecs, akin to DTS and Dolby Digital. If you wish to go all-out, it is highly effective sufficient to deal with a 7.1-channel encompass system.

Apart from TVs, CD gamers, and speaker tools, you may additionally discover optical ports on some cable packing containers, DVD gamers, Blu-ray gamers, and recreation consoles. You may even discover it on some computer systems, though I can not recall ever seeing that myself.

So what’s improper with optical audio?

An evolutionary dead-end

Dolby Atmos displayed on a receiver.

Optical has been eclipsed by HDMI, or somewhat an related know-how, ARC (Audio Return Channel). This eliminates the necessity for devoted audio cables, and allows you to output audio from any system related to your TV. It will possibly doubtlessly significantly simplify your setup, as an example letting you join your console and Blu-ray participant to your soundbar, which then connects to your TV — no receiver wanted.

One other ARC benefit is assist for CEC management. Meaning your common distant can’t solely flip audio system on and off, however regulate their quantity as should you have been controlling the TV’s inner sound. Optically-based audio system may have a separate distant, or “coaching” to acknowledge IR blasts.

Optical connections are restricted to 384Kbps, which simply is not sufficient to deal with the information wants of one thing like Atmos.

As if that weren’t sufficient, the most effective model of ARC — eARC — gives dramatically higher bandwidth, as much as 37Mbps (megabits per second). This allows uncompressed encompass codecs like DTS-HD and Dolby TrueHD, in addition to object-based 3D codecs like DTS:X and Dolby Atmos. You will not essentially discover the distinction versus compressed and uncompressed tracks, however solely 3D codecs can venture sounds over your head. Optical connections are restricted to 384Kbps, which simply is not sufficient to deal with the information wants of one thing like Atmos.

A relatively minor concern is the vary and fragility of optical cables. Cheaper plastic ones are ineffective past 10 meters (about 32.8 ft), and absolutely anything you purchase can be ultra-thin, making all of it too straightforward to crimp or bend in a method that blocks mild alerts. I’ve all the time felt like I’ve needed to deal with optical cables like I’d high quality china.
